    CVE-2026-67613

    CyberPanel before 3.0.0 contains a path traversal vulnerability that allows authenticated administrators to read arbitrary files from the server filesystem by supplying unsanitized file paths to the cloudAPI ReadReport endpoint. Attackers can manipulate the reportFile parameter in the JSON request body, which is passed directly to open() in cloudManager.py without validation or allowlisting, enabling traversal to any file readable by the root-privileged CyberPanel process including credential files, SSL and SSH private keys, and JWT secret files.
